Popcorn Ceiling Renovation in Waco, TX
Popcorn ceiling renovation services involve the removal or updating of textured ceiling finishes commonly found in homes and commercial properties. These projects typically include scraping away old popcorn textures, smoothing the surface, and applying new finishes such as flat, knockdown, or other modern ceiling styles. Property owners often request this service to improve interior aesthetics, increase property value, or address issues like staining, cracking, or deterioration of the existing popcorn texture.
Before requesting popcorn ceiling renovation, homeowners usually want to understand the scope of the work involved, potential mess, and whether the existing ceiling contains materials like asbestos. It’s also helpful to consider the desired final appearance, whether a smooth ceiling or a different texture, and to ensure proper preparation and cleanup are included. Clarifying these details can help ensure the project meets expectations and enhances the overall look of the space.
